The team currently running City Pub, earlier ran the Capital Pub company, which Greene King took over in 2011, paying circa £2.35p per share. Above I'm responding to Ditchsid who cited Capital Pub as support for the notion that City will be bought out at some point.

From my point of view City Pub has a much greater chance of being taken over than, say, Youngs or Fullers, because the management team with signficant stakes have a track record of being receptive to take overs and do not have the weight of tradition and longevity hanging over them as with the much larger independent groups. £2.80 per share for City Pub would be small change for some of the big, international brewers and they can pick up a tasty portfolio of well-run pubs.
